Transaction 908155710e78bba3e9c9ba13ae725efc05c08a65d2f8d752ae05fb58854c9e83
1 Input
1 Output
-
908155710e78bba3e9c9ba13ae725efc05c08a65d2f8d752ae05fb58854c9e83:0
- value
- 1051709
- script pubkey
- OP_0 OP_PUSHBYTES_20 5170f8f838f8e8b973e14f262ac3f7f23ec22438
- address
- bc1q29c037pclr5tjulpfunz4slh7glvyfpcy653f4